Output 962126dde83815284dcd05f9a243276d3860f4b35858ace4a53125823fd816c6:7

value
171154
script pubkey
OP_0 OP_PUSHBYTES_20 c3b56c29b2ca9773bc378fef003ddda815a78971
address
bc1qcw6kc2dje2th80ph3lhsq0wa4q260zt3ywqq2w
transaction
962126dde83815284dcd05f9a243276d3860f4b35858ace4a53125823fd816c6